Which Key Features Should You Look for in a Solar Charge Controller for a Renogy Battery?
The key features to look for in a solar charge controller for a Renogy 100W 12-volt suitcase solar battery include:
- MPPT Technology: Maximum Power Point Tracking (MPPT) technology optimizes the energy harvest from your solar panels by continually adjusting to the maximum power point. This feature is essential for maximizing efficiency, especially in varying weather conditions or during partial shading.
- Battery Compatibility: Ensure that the charge controller is compatible with the specific type of battery you are using, such as AGM, Gel, or Lithium. This compatibility is crucial for effective charging and to prevent potential damage to your battery.
- Load Control Features: Look for controllers that offer load control features, such as load disconnects to prevent over-discharging. This ensures that your connected devices will not draw too much power from the battery, thus prolonging battery life.
- Display and Monitoring: A built-in display or the ability to connect to a mobile app allows you to monitor the performance of the solar system in real-time. This feature can provide insights into battery status, solar input, and overall system performance, helping you make informed decisions.
- Protection Features: Good controllers should have built-in protections against overcharging, over-discharging, short circuits, and reverse polarity. These safety features are vital in preventing damage to both the solar panels and the battery.
- Efficiency Ratings: Look for controllers with high efficiency ratings, typically above 90%. Higher efficiency means less energy loss during the charging process, allowing more power to be used effectively.
- Temperature Compensation: This feature adjusts the charging voltage based on the temperature, ensuring optimal charging in different environmental conditions. This capability helps to maintain battery health and performance over time.
- Size and Portability: Since you are using a suitcase solar setup, consider the size and weight of the controller. A compact and lightweight design will make it easier to transport and set up your solar system.
How Do PWM and MPPT Technologies Differ, and Which Is Best for Your Needs?
When choosing a controller for the Renogy 100W 12-volt suitcase solar battery, understanding the differences between PWM (Pulse Width Modulation) and MPPT (Maximum Power Point Tracking) technologies is essential for maximizing efficiency and performance.
PWM (Pulse Width Modulation):
– Simple and cost-effective.
– Regulates voltage by switching on and off rapidly.
– Works efficiently with smaller solar systems, usually up to 400 watts.
– Typically has lower energy conversion efficiency than MPPT, leading to some wasted power under certain conditions.
MPPT (Maximum Power Point Tracking):
– More complex and expensive, but highly efficient.
– Continuously adjusts the input voltage and current to find the maximum power available from the solar panels.
– Particularly beneficial for larger systems or where solar panel output fluctuates significantly.
– Can increase energy harvest by up to 30%, making it ideal for maximizing battery charging efficiency in varying sunlight conditions.
In general, for a Renogy 100W setup, a PWM controller suffices for straightforward applications. However, if long-term efficiency and enhanced performance are priorities, especially in diverse weather conditions, consider opting for an MPPT controller.

How Can You Successfully Install a Solar Charge Controller in Your Renogy System?
Successfully installing a solar charge controller in your Renogy 100W 12-volt suitcase solar battery system involves a few key steps. This process ensures optimal performance and protects your battery from overcharging.
-
Gather Required Tools: Before starting, gather tools such as a screwdriver, wire strippers, and a multimeter to check connections.
-
Locate the Controller: Position your solar charge controller in a shaded, well-ventilated area, away from moisture or excessive heat.
-
Wiring Connections:
– Connect the solar panel wires (positive and negative) from the suitcase to the solar input terminals on the controller. Ensure you observe the polarity: positive to positive and negative to negative.
– Next, connect the wires to the battery terminals, again ensuring correct polarity. It’s advisable to connect the controller to the battery before connecting the solar panels to avoid potential damage. -
Secure All Connections: Double-check all connections for tightness and correct alignment to prevent any power loss or short circuits.
-
Power On: Once everything is connected, power on the system. Use a multimeter to verify the voltage at the battery and ensure the charge controller is functioning correctly.
By following these steps, you ensure your solar setup operates efficiently, maximizing the energy harvested for your needs.
What Common Mistakes Should You Avoid When Choosing a Charge Controller for Your 100W Setup?
When selecting a charge controller for your Renogy 100W 12-volt suitcase solar battery setup, it’s crucial to avoid common mistakes that can lead to inefficiencies or equipment damage.
- Choosing the Wrong Type: It’s important to select the right type of charge controller, either PWM (Pulse Width Modulation) or MPPT (Maximum Power Point Tracking), based on your power needs. PWM controllers are typically less expensive and suitable for smaller setups, while MPPT controllers are more efficient, especially in low light conditions, making them ideal for maximizing the output of your 100W solar panel.
- Underestimating Current Ratings: Ensure that the charge controller’s current rating exceeds the output of your solar panel. For a 100W panel operating at 12 volts, the maximum current can be around 8.33 amps, so a controller should ideally handle at least 10 amps to provide a safety margin and account for any potential spikes.
- Ignoring Compatibility: Verify that the charge controller is compatible with the battery type you are using, such as AGM, gel, or lithium. Each battery type has specific charging requirements, and using an incompatible controller can lead to overcharging or undercharging, which can damage the battery and reduce its lifespan.
- Failing to Consider Features: Look for additional features such as temperature compensation, load control, and display options that enhance usability and protect your setup. These features can provide better management of the charging process and improve the overall performance of your solar system.
- Neglecting Installation Guidelines: Improper installation can lead to poor performance or even failure of the charge controller. Always follow manufacturer instructions, including the appropriate gauge of wiring, to ensure safe and efficient operation of your solar charging system.
